Kim Jong Il Provides Field Guidance to Pyongyang Textile Mill
Pyongyang, July 30 (KCNA) -- General Secretary Kim Jong Il gave field guidance to the updated Pyongyang Textile Mill Thursday on the occasion of the 63rd anniversary of the promulgation of the historic Law on Sex Equality.

He first went round the monument to the on-the-spot instructions of President Kim Il Sung and the monument to his field guidance, a room for the education in the revolutionary history and a room devoted to the history of the mill.

Seeing valuable historic relics and mementoes, he said that the Korean people would always remember the profound loving care and benevolence of the President.

He said that the core of the thoughts and practice of the President in his life was the spirit of absolute devoted service to the people, underscoring the need for the officials to always bear this lofty intention of the President deep in their minds and fully embody it in their work and life.

He then made the rounds of the general spinning shop, the knitting thread shop, the general dyeing shop, the compound covered with green foliage of various species of trees and other places of the mill for hours to learn in detail about the modernization and production at the mill.

It is an admirable success that the workers of the mill successfully carried out the modernization by their own efforts and with their own technology at a time when they were hard pressed for everything and established cultured ways in production and life, he noted. He highly appreciated their feats and extended thanks to all the officials, workers and technicians of the mill.

He met with a weaver Jon Ok Hwa, a spinner Kim Pok Sil, the head of a shop Ri Myong Ok, all labor heroines who have worked at the mill for years and weavers Mun Kang Sun and Ri Myong Sun and spinners Sonu Ok and Han Chol Ok, young labor innovators, and highly praised their patriotic devotion and gave them warm pep talks.
